Purpose of ISO/IEC 27031:2025
The purpose of ISO/IEC 27031:2025 is to provide guidance for preparing ICT environments so they can better support business continuity requirements. It is generally used to align technical readiness activities with organizational continuity planning, helping define what should be reviewed, validated, and maintained across systems, services, and supporting infrastructure. For engineering and compliance teams, the document offers a practical basis for risk management, technical review, and documented evaluation of readiness measures.
